Janet Ruth Heller on Querying Publishers  Today's guest for the SAT (Successful Author Talk) is Janet Ruth Heller. Janet is a poet, literary critic, college professor, essayist, playwright, and fiction writer. She is a past president of the Society for the Study of Midwestern Literature, and is currently president of the Michigan College English Association. She has a Ph.D. in English Language and Literature from the University of Chicago, and has published three books of poetry: Exodus (WordTech Communications, 2014), Folk Concert: Changing Times (Anaphora Literary Press, 2012), and Traffic Stop (Finishing Line Press, 2011). She is the founding mother and former editor of Primavera, a literary magazine. Primavera has won awards from Chicago Women in Publishing and the Illinois Arts Council and grants from the Coordinating Council of Literary Magazines and the National Endowment for the Arts. Editing & Publishing Workshop with Janet Ruth Heller at the Boston Public Library on Saturday, July 9, 2016 from 11 a.m. to 12:30 p.m.

Saturday, July 9, 2016 from 11 a.m. to 12:30 p.m.—Author Janet Ruth Heller will do a workshop for teenagers about the editing and publishing process at the Boston Public Library.  This workshop is free of charge and open to the public.  The location is the Central Library in Copley Square, 700 Boylston Street, Boston MA 02116.
